Offer document reviewed and approved

NOT FOR PUBLIC DISTRIBUTION, DIRECTLY OR INDIRECTLY, IN OR INTO THE UNITED

STATES OF AMERICA, SOUTH AFRICA, CANADA, AUSTRALIA OR JAPAN

27 July 2010 - Reference is made to the stock exchange notices from BW Offshore

Limited ("BW Offshore" or "BWO") of 21 June 2010, 30 June 2010 and 14 July 2010

regarding the intention to make a voluntary exchange offer (the "Offer") for all

of the issued and outstanding shares of Prosafe Production Public Limited

("Prosafe Production") not currently owned, directly or indirectly, by BW

Offshore.

The offer document and information memorandum containing equivalent information

as a prospectus (the "Offer Document") has been reviewed and approved by the

Oslo Stock Exchange in accordance with Section 6-14 of the Norwegian Securities

Trading Act and reviewed by the Financial Supervisory Authority of Norway in

accordance with Section 7-13, cf. Sections 7-4 no 6 and 7-5 no 7 of the

Norwegian Securities Trading Act.

The consideration in the Offer is 1.2 shares in BW Offshore plus NOK 2.00 in

cash for each share in Prosafe Production. If Prosafe Production completes the

sale of its turret and swivel business no later than two Norwegian business days

prior to expiry of the offer period on conditions as set out in the Offer

Document, the consideration shall be 1.2 shares in BW Offshore shares plus NOK

5.25 in cash for each share in Prosafe Production. The offer period is from and

including 29 July 2010 to and including 25 August 2010 at 17:30 (CET).

About BW Offshore

BW Offshore is one of the world's leading FPSO contractors and a market leader

within advanced offshore loading and production systems to the oil and gas

industry. BW Offshore has more than 25 years' experience and has successfully

delivered 14 FPSO projects and 50 turrets and offshore terminals. BW Offshore's

technology division APL has delivered solutions for production vessels, storage

vessels and tankers in a wide range of field developments. Adapting through

competence, in-house technology, solid project execution and operational

excellence, BW Offshore ensures that customer needs are met through versatile

solutions for offshore oil and gas projects. BW Offshore has a global network

with offices in Europe, Asia Pacific, West Africa and the Americas. BW Offshore

has 1,100 employees and is list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ange. For more
